S. Šesnić is a scholar working on Nuclear and High Energy Physics, Astronomy and Astrophysics and Electrical and Electronic Engineering. According to data from OpenAlex, S. Šesnić has authored 100 papers receiving a total of 1.6k indexed citations (citations by other indexed papers that have themselves been cited), including 53 papers in Nuclear and High Energy Physics, 46 papers in Astronomy and Astrophysics and 33 papers in Electrical and Electronic Engineering. Recurrent topics in S. Šesnić’s work include Magnetic confinement fusion research (52 papers), Lightning and Electromagnetic Phenomena (24 papers) and Ionosphere and magnetosphere dynamics (22 papers). S. Šesnić is often cited by papers focused on Magnetic confinement fusion research (52 papers), Lightning and Electromagnetic Phenomena (24 papers) and Ionosphere and magnetosphere dynamics (22 papers). S. Šesnić collaborates with scholars based in United States, Croatia and France. S. Šesnić's co-authors include S. Günter, A. Gude, ASDEX Upgrade Team, Dragan Poljak, M. Maraschek, K. W. Hill, S. von Goeler, A. J. Lichtenberg, H. Zohm and R. Hülse and has published in prestigious journals such as Physical Review Letters, Review of Scientific Instruments and Journal of the Optical Society of America A.
